work hard work smart

专注于Java后端开发。 不断总结,举一反三。
  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

随笔分类 -  S.Android 工具使用

摘要:1 地址:http://subversion.apache.org/packages.html#windows 找到windows下的svn客户端工具。选择Win32Svn 进行安装。 一般环境变量会自动添加,直接在cmd命令中输入: svn help: 就能开始svn命令的帮助了 2 subver 阅读全文

posted @ 2014-06-04 14:36 work hard work smart 阅读(1486) 评论(0) 推荐(0)

摘要:为App签名(为apk签名)原文地址这篇文章是Android开发人员的必备知识,是我特别为大家整理和总结的,不求完美,但是有用。1.签名的意义 为了保证每个应用程序开发商合法ID,防止部分开放商可能通过使用相同的Package Name来混淆替换已经安装的程序,我们需要对我们发布的APK文件进行... 阅读全文

posted @ 2014-04-22 14:34 work hard work smart 阅读(841) 评论(0) 推荐(0)

摘要:简单配置版本:Eclipse設置一、window->Preferences-> General-Editors->Text Editors ,右边勾选insert spaces for tabs。二、window->Preferences->Java->Code Style-> Formatter 点击edit, 选择spaces only,最后在最上面的Profile Name改一个名字,保存就OK了。详细配置版本:Eclipse设置软tab(用4个空格字符代替)及默认utf-8文件编码(unix)原文地址本文摘要:1、如何配置Eclipse中编辑器 阅读全文

posted @ 2014-02-24 10:54 work hard work smart 阅读(444) 评论(0) 推荐(0)

摘要:刚更新了Android sdk 19,但是出现以下两个问题,浪费我2个小时的时间,现在将我遇到的问题和解决方法总结如下:问题1:打开eclipse点更新后,出现This Android SDK requires Android Developer Toolkit version 22.0.0 or above.原文地址本人最近在操作更新ANDROID SDK时出现类似于题目中的错误,是一启动ECLIPSE时。按照弹出的提示进行更新。但是,我现在只是想恢复到原先的开发环境。于是找到本文,方法有效!!!windows 下面安装Android虚拟机,有时候选择更新SDK后,在Eclipse pref 阅读全文

posted @ 2013-12-20 16:42 work hard work smart 阅读(11042) 评论(0) 推荐(1)

摘要:序言:-------------此文档旨在描述Android.mk文件的语法,Android.mk文件为Android NDK(原生开发)描述了你C/C++源文件。为了明白下面的内容,你必须已经阅读了docs/OVERVIEW.TXT的内容,它解释了Android.mk文件扮演的角色和用途。概述:---------写一个Android.mk文件是为了向生成系统描述你的源代码。更明确的说:- 这个文件实际上是GNU Make文件的一小片段,它会被生成系统解析一次或多次。因此,你应该在Android.mk里尽量少地声明变量,而不要误以为在解析的过程中没有任何东西被定义。- 该文件的语法的明的人为了 阅读全文

posted @ 2013-12-18 19:02 work hard work smart 阅读(808) 评论(0) 推荐(0)

摘要:android 工程出现感叹号错误:错误问题分析,曾经导入的jar已经不存在工程目录中,project从其他地方导入时。没有及时更新,比如说svn下载到.project的文件,或者是path的文件。问题解决:打开 build path——>configure build path /project 把里面的错误路径 remove.再重新clearn下就ok了原文地址 阅读全文

posted @ 2013-11-29 17:11 work hard work smart 阅读(337) 评论(0) 推荐(0)

摘要:ubuntu 使用adb shell命令配置在ubuntu下使用adb 命令识别Android设备需配置adb_usb.ini文件文件路径: ~/.android/ ,若不存在创建该文件。adb_usb.ini 在文件里面输入插入设备id信息,如下面1368就是设备的id。获取设备id方法:输入lsusb命令root@android:~/.android$ lsusbBus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hubBus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 阅读全文

posted @ 2013-11-21 16:08 work hard work smart 阅读(867) 评论(0) 推荐(0)

摘要:Google Play开发者账号注册与失败申诉攻略这篇文章我在网上找了好久,是在Google play进行开发者账号注册方法,介绍的很详细。现在分享一下。[原文地址]为了方便开发者们注册谷歌的官方安卓电子市场,有米开发者博客曾发布了《Android Market 账号注册和应用发布教程》。但自从Android Market 改名为Google Play后,注册方法也有部分改变。所以有米特别收集了其他开发者最近注册成功的经验,给最近想要注册的朋友参考一下。Google Play开发者账号注册流程1.登陆您的Gmail账号,如果没有请先注册登录地址:https://play.google.com/ 阅读全文

posted @ 2013-11-01 14:24 work hard work smart 阅读(749) 评论(0) 推荐(0)

摘要:Android的界面设计工具 DroidDrawDroidDraw 下载地址:http://code.google.com/p/droiddraw/如图也可以使用在线的版本(http://www.droiddraw.org/)。 阅读全文

posted @ 2013-09-26 15:26 work hard work smart 阅读(381) 评论(0) 推荐(0)

摘要:linux ubuntu系统下,adb不是内部命令原文地址linux ubuntu系统下,adb不是内部命令 解决方法: 1、sudo gedit ~/.bashrc 2、将下面的两句加到上面打开的文件里 export ANDROID_HOME=/home/jason/Develop_SDK/android-sdk-linux_86 export PATH=$PATH:$ANDROID_HOME/tools 最新的SDK要改为:$PATH:$ANDROID_HOMOE/platform-tools 注意:“/home/jason/Develop_SDK/android-sdk-linux_86 阅读全文

posted @ 2013-09-05 12:53 work hard work smart 阅读(3152) 评论(0) 推荐(0)

摘要:MAT Memory Analyzer Tool 插件安装(图解)原文地址@author YHC前段时间做了一个项目,Exception in thread "main" java.lang.OutOfMemoryError: Java heap space出现这个错误,所以需要查找原因,所以就用到这个工具,安装比较麻烦,贴出来和大家共享一下:第一步:下载Eclipse MAT下载地址:http://www.eclipse.org/mat/downloads.php第二步:下载之后将压缩包解压,放置到Myeclipse 的\MyEclipse 9\dropins目录下解压后 阅读全文

posted @ 2013-08-23 17:23 work hard work smart 阅读(740) 评论(0) 推荐(0)

摘要:Android monkey介绍原文地址1 简略monkey是android下自动化测试比较重要的的一个工具,该工具可以运行在host端或者设备(模拟器或真实设备)。它会向系统发送随机事件流(即模拟用户各种操作:点击、滑动、AP切换等),对单个程序或者整个系统进行压力测试。如果要具体查看该工具的实现源码,可参考development/cmds/monkey/下的源码。其实很简单的,里面主要使用到IWindowManager这个接口类来传送事件,而这个接口类的实现是系统的一个服务例程。这里不进行详细说明。2 命令参数说明monkey命令后面可带有很多参数,主要分为四大类:1)基本配置,例如测试事 阅读全文

posted @ 2013-08-22 09:38 work hard work smart 阅读(1317) 评论(0) 推荐(0)

摘要:http://wenku.baidu.com/view/0bffafff700abb68a882fb04.html 阅读全文

posted @ 2013-08-13 11:17 work hard work smart 阅读(221) 评论(0) 推荐(0)

摘要:Eclipse调试常用技巧 原文地址 记得刚刚毕业的时候,自己连断点也不会打,当时还在用JCreate,就连毕业设计也是用System.out找Bug的,想想真的很笨。开始工作后,一个星期过去了,在一个1、2百万行的系统中找Bug,我依然在用System.out,当时最痛苦的就是修改代码,每次找到疑 阅读全文

posted @ 2013-08-12 18:05 work hard work smart 阅读(320) 评论(0) 推荐(0)

摘要:删除Android自带软件方法1.在电脑上打开cmd,然后输入命令adb remountadb shellsu2.接着就是Linux命令行模式了,输入cd system/app3然后输入ls回车.这时候列表显示了system/app里面的所有文件。4.开始删除吧.xxx.odex和xxx.apk我们要删除这2个文件,敲入以下命令:rm xxx.*如果还没成功,执行第五步:5. E:\>adb pull /data/system/packages.xml 删除相关信息 E:\>adb push /packages.xml /data/systemE:\>adb rebootad 阅读全文

posted @ 2013-08-06 18:21 work hard work smart 阅读(9920) 评论(0) 推荐(1)

摘要:首先分享一个很好学习Git的的网站 http://git-scm.com/book/zh-tw/Git教程(原文地址)本教程通过命令行来阐述分布版本控制系统Git的使用。演示系统选取的是Linux(Ubuntu),但是在其他系统上也能功能,例如Windows系统。内容索引1. Git 1.1. Git是何方神圣?1.2.重要的术语 1.3.索引(stage)2. 安装3. 配置3.1. 用户信息3.2. 高亮显示3.3. 忽略特定的文件3.4. 使用.gitkeep来追踪空的文件夹4. 开始操作Git4.1. 创建内容4.2. 创建仓库、添加文件和提交更改4.3. diff命令和commit修 阅读全文

posted @ 2013-08-01 09:30 work hard work smart 阅读(4560) 评论(0) 推荐(0)

摘要:1、在Window Or Liunx下,使用Eclipse的Android SDK Manager下载SDK源码、 2、使用下载的SDK源码 指定源码的路径为自己下载的SKD路径即可。 阅读全文

posted @ 2013-05-20 17:14 work hard work smart 阅读(167) 评论(0) 推荐(0)

摘要:还没有给大家说关于联想a65手机获取root权限的方法呢,下在就来给大家说一下这个手机怎么获取root权限吧,其实root的方法还是挺简单的,只要大家按照教程里的步骤操作就可以了,下面来看看具体的操作吧:一:准备工作:1:先在电脑端安装91手机助手(也可以是豌豆荚,但听说三键开机状态下驱动安不上):我用的XP原版,会提示电脑安装Microsoft.NET.Framework2.0,根据提示安装这一文件之后,91手机助手顺利启动。2:准备一根数据线3:下载root工具包,点击这里下载二:开始root操作:1:打开手机,设置手机为“USB调试”:步骤如下:设置——选择应用程序-——开发——-USB 阅读全文

posted @ 2013-05-04 10:54 work hard work smart 阅读(304) 评论(0) 推荐(0)

摘要:android 导入项目 项目中文字乱码问题 原文地址乱码问题出现了几次,一直没有在意,今天又出现了,现总结如下:eclipse之所以会出现乱码问题是因为eclipse编辑器选择的编码规则是可变的。一般默认都是UTF-8或者GBK,当从外部导入的一个工程时,如果该工程的编码方式与eclipse中设置的编码方式不同,就会产生中文的乱码问题,这其中还有几种情况。如果导入的整个工程的编码方式与eclipse的编码方式有冲突,那么这个工程里所有的中文 都是乱码;如果所有工程的编码方式与eclipse工作空间的编码方式有冲突,那么所有的工程里的中文都有可能是乱码。对于eclipse工作空间 ,eclip 阅读全文

posted @ 2013-04-28 10:57 work hard work smart 阅读(379) 评论(0) 推荐(0)

摘要:Android 内存监测工具 DDMS --> Heap .原文地址用 Heap监测应用进程使用内存情况的步骤如下:1. 启动eclipse后,切换到DDMS透视图,并确认Devices视图、Heap视图都是打开的;2. 将手机通过USB链接至电脑,链接时需要确认手机是处于“USB调试”模式,而不是作为“Mass Storage”;3. 链接成功后,在DDMS的Devices视图中将会显示手机设备的序列号,以及设备中正在运行的部分进程信息;4. 点击选中想要监测的进程,比如system_process进程;5. 点击选中Devices视图界面中最上方一排图标中的“Update Heap” 阅读全文

posted @ 2013-03-28 09:55 work hard work smart 阅读(188) 评论(0) 推荐(0)